La Bistro Mediterranean Kitchen invites you to indulge in a delightful culinary journey through the Mediterranean with its extensive menu of authentic dishes. Established in 2015 as a family-run restaurant, La Bistro prides itself on sourcing only the freshest ingredients to create flavorful meals that cater to diverse tastes. The warm and welcoming atmosphere makes it an ideal spot for family gatherings or casual dining with friends. Diners can expect exceptional service and a commitment to customer satisfaction, ensuring that every visit is enjoyable. Experience the essence of Mediterranean hospitality at La Bistro and discover why it remains a favorite among locals.

  • In Roman times, Newcastle – then called Pons Aelius – was a fort on Hadrian’s Wall, and during the Saxon period, it was known as Monk Chester on account of its many religious houses. The city owes its present name to William the Conqueror who, like Hadrian before him, recognized its strategic importance.
